Mission and Objectives
GLOWA fights against human trafficking and the damage it creates in our communities throughout the Northwest region of Cameroon through community education to prevent trafficking, support for victims, and advocacy on their behalf. Through these works, GLOWA aims to nurture a culture of respect for human rights, particularly those of children and women, in the region and fight against the systematic abuses faced by the most vulnerable.
Context
Global Welfare Association (GLOWA) is a women-led grassroots organization based in the conflict-affected North West Region of Cameroon. GLOWA implements programs in mental health support, gender justice, youth and women’s economic empowerment and legal advocacy for vulnerable populations.
Currently, GLOWA’s website does not fully reflect the organization’s impact or support efficient communication with donors, partners and communities. A redesigned website is critical to improve visibility, share program achievements and facilitate engagement and resource mobilization.
This assignment provides an opportunity for a volunteer to lead a team of online contributors, ensuring the website redesign is well-coordinated, high-quality and aligned with GLOWA’s mission. The role directly supports GLOWA’s ability to strengthen its digital presence and amplify its impact in the region.
Task Description
Global Welfare Association (GLOWA), a women-led grassroots NGO in Cameroon, seeks an Online Volunteer to coordinate the redesign of its website. The volunteer will guide a team of online volunteers, ensuring smooth collaboration, timely delivery and alignment with GLOWA’s mission and branding. Responsibilities include tracking deliverables, facilitating communication among volunteers, providing quality checks and serving as the main liaison between GLOWA and the volunteer team. This role strengthens GLOWA’s digital presence, improves visibility of its programs and enhances resource mobilization for gender justice and community support initiatives.
